VIDEO: Kwabena Owusu scores as Qarabag hold Ferencvaros in UCL qualifiers

Published: 3 years ago
Ghana Players Abroad

Ghana forward Kwabena Owusu scored for Qarabag in their 1-1 draw against Ferencvaros in Wednesday’s Champions League first leg, third qualifying round encounter.

Owusu, who lasted the entire duration of the game put up an impressive display as he helped his side avoid defeat against the reigning Hungarian champions at the Tofiq Bahramov Republican Stadium.

Ferencvaros took an early lead in the 17th minute of the game through Cote d’Ivoire’s Franck Boli who beat goalkeeper Shakhrudin Magomedaliyev.

However, Owusu bagged the equaliser for the hosts after he was teed up by Philip Ozobic in the 34th minute.

In the second half, the teams were matched evenly as the game ended on a no winner.

Both teams will face each other in Budapest on Tuesday, August 9, 2022 with the winners on aggregate qualifying for the next round where they will join 11 other teams in the play-off round.

Owusu has made five appearances for Qarabag so far this season and scored two  goals in the process.
